Bengaluru Celebrates World Music Day with Concerts, Talks, and Workshops
Bengaluru: World Music Day Events on June 21

Bengaluru is gearing up to celebrate World Music Day on June 21 with an eclectic mix of events, ranging from jazz and folk performances to Karnatik music and cross-cultural collaborations. The city will host concerts, talks, and workshops that cater to music enthusiasts of all tastes.

Diverse Musical Offerings

The lineup includes performances by renowned artists and emerging talents, ensuring a vibrant atmosphere across various venues. Jazz lovers can enjoy soulful renditions, while folk music aficionados will be treated to traditional melodies from different regions. Karnatik music, a classical form from South India, will also take center stage, highlighting its intricate rhythms and compositions.

Cross-Cultural Collaborations

One of the highlights of the day will be cross-cultural collaborations, where musicians from different genres and backgrounds come together to create unique fusion sounds. These collaborations aim to bridge musical traditions and offer audiences a fresh auditory experience.

Talks and Workshops

In addition to performances, the celebrations will feature talks by music experts discussing the history and evolution of various genres. Workshops will provide hands-on learning opportunities for attendees, covering topics such as rhythm, improvisation, and instrument techniques.

Community Engagement

World Music Day in Bengaluru is not just about professional musicians; it also encourages community participation. Open mic sessions and jam circles will allow amateur musicians to showcase their talent and interact with seasoned artists.
